About Me

My first job was as an officer in the British Army (I didn't know any better at the time!) followed by a period in a similar industry, after which I decided to pursue my love of painting. My subsequent classical training in Florence and love of artists such as Klimt play a strong role in much of my work, where the combination of decorative design and naturalism creates a personal piece, the one complimenting the other.....I hope.
